Answer:
The speed of plane B relative to plane A is 392.25 mph.
Step-by-step explanation:
Speed of plane A = 440 mph north east
speed of plane B = 550 mph north
speed of plane A = ![440(cos 45 \widehat{i} + sin 45 \widehat{j})=311.1 \widehat{i} + 311.1 \widehat{j}](https://tex.z-dn.net/?f=440%28cos%2045%20%5Cwidehat%7Bi%7D%20%2B%20sin%2045%20%5Cwidehat%7Bj%7D%29%3D311.1%20%5Cwidehat%7Bi%7D%20%2B%20311.1%20%5Cwidehat%7Bj%7D)
speed of plane B = ![550 \widehat{j}](https://tex.z-dn.net/?f=550%20%5Cwidehat%7Bj%7D)
Speed of plane B with respect to plane A is
= speed of plane B - speed of plane A
![=550 \widehat{j} - 311.1 \widehat{i} - 311.1 \widehat{j}\\\\=-311.1 \widehat{i} + 238.9 \widehat{j}\\\\= \sqrt{311.1^2 + 238.9^2 }\\\\=392.25 mph](https://tex.z-dn.net/?f=%3D550%20%5Cwidehat%7Bj%7D%20-%20311.1%20%5Cwidehat%7Bi%7D%20-%20311.1%20%5Cwidehat%7Bj%7D%5C%5C%5C%5C%3D-311.1%20%5Cwidehat%7Bi%7D%20%2B%20238.9%20%5Cwidehat%7Bj%7D%5C%5C%5C%5C%3D%20%5Csqrt%7B311.1%5E2%20%2B%20238.9%5E2%20%7D%5C%5C%5C%5C%3D392.25%20mph)
